Transaction 91ae522cf9111bacb8257d9ae47ca4e415d8f836a96b03f93368c4aee99f85d2
1 Input
1 Output
-
91ae522cf9111bacb8257d9ae47ca4e415d8f836a96b03f93368c4aee99f85d2:0
- value
- 16772512
- script pubkey
- OP_0 OP_PUSHBYTES_32 d9b48e703a9d2752f6e5a44467704fcd6b013ae7a0fed612e13c9700c5b510de
- address
- bc1qmx6guup6n5n49ah953zxwuz0e44szwh85rldvyhp8jtsp3d4zr0qtgnhyy